summary refs log tree commit diff stats
Commit message (Collapse)AuthorAgeFilesLines
* implemented tables.addAraq2011-06-114-11/+26
|
* got rid of nstrtabs and nhashes modulesAraq2011-06-1020-362/+57
|
* fixed system.nim to use the proper getTypeInfo magicAraq2011-06-102-2/+6
|
* Merge branch 'master' of github.com:Araq/NimrodAraq2011-06-105-3/+210
|\
| * Added typeinfo moduledom962011-06-095-3/+210
| |
* | Bugfix: no #line dir with 0 generatedAraq2011-06-107-16/+15
|/
* basic generic collections implemented and testedAraq2011-06-0710-95/+512
|
* bugfix: generic instantiation across module boundariesAraq2011-06-0611-241/+418
|
* overloading of [] for derefence operation should be possible nowAraq2011-06-053-5/+31
|
* ugh cannot get rid of rawEcho yet because old compiler relies on itAraq2011-06-051-0/+3
|
* threads clean up their heapAraq2011-06-049-46/+93
|
* bugfixes for semantic checking; thread implementation pushed the compilerAraq2011-06-048-126/+154
|
* first steps to thread local heapsAraq2011-06-0221-633/+1072
|
* bugfix second attempt: osprocAraq2011-05-221-0/+1
|
* bugfix stderr osprocAraq2011-05-221-7/+4
|
* Merge branch 'master' of git@github.com:Araq/NimrodAraq2011-05-225-950/+1460
|\
| * Added a helpful iterator to redis. Fixed some issues with stderr in osproc. ↵dom962011-05-225-950/+1460
| | | | | | | | Fixed doc generation issues.
* | thread progressAraq2011-05-221-5/+6
|/
* pthread_key_t is respected to be an opaque type ...Araq2011-05-203-17/+18
|
* further progress for multi-threadingAraq2011-05-1910-176/+202
|
* threads with --gc:boehm may work now :-)Araq2011-05-172-51/+46
|
* still playing with threadsAraq2011-05-173-15/+17
|
* lexer, parser cleanup; boehm gc for mac os xAraq2011-05-176-100/+104
|
* thread support: next iterationAraq2011-05-176-120/+194
|
* store a pointer to thread local storage to make the GC happyAraq2011-05-162-4/+5
|
* further steps for thread support; bootstrapping should require unzip C ↵Araq2011-05-1621-421/+372
| | | | sources and ./build.sh
* copy replaced by substrAraq2011-05-143-6/+6
|
* Merge branch 'master' of git@github.com:Araq/NimrodAraq2011-05-144-16/+53
|\
| * Merge branch 'master' of github.com:Araq/Nimroddom962011-05-1443-180/+265
| |\
| * | fixed some redis commands; fixed bindAddr and scgi now doesn't bind to all ↵dom962011-05-144-16/+53
| | | | | | | | | | | | addresses. copy and delete for json module.
* | | mmdisp [] instead of ^Araq2011-05-141-6/+6
| |/ |/|
* | deprecated system.copy: use system.substr insteadAraq2011-05-1431-109/+122
| |
* | got rid of isLiftedAraq2011-05-142-11/+4
| |
* | loop unrolled for stack markingAraq2011-05-133-1/+33
| |
* | debug build works again; sorryAraq2011-05-094-54/+55
| |
* | Merge branch 'master' of github.com:Araq/NimrodAraq2011-05-091-5/+22
|\|
| * tester now outputs jsondom962011-05-081-5/+22
| |
* | threadvar alternativeAraq2011-05-094-10/+24
| |
* | newStringOfCap implemented and used to optimize some procsAraq2011-05-0810-21/+53
|/
* bugfix: don't change OSError()'s behaviourAraq2011-05-082-14/+11
|
* select() for processes; copyDir() for os.dom962011-05-074-20/+129
|
* gc tweaking to gain a few percent of performanceAraq2011-05-0713-155/+185
|
* fixes #12Araq2011-05-023-61/+54
|
* little repo cleanupAraq2011-05-02111-115103/+53
|
* Merge branch 'master' of github.com:Araq/NimrodAraq2011-05-016-38/+223
|\
| * The sockets module supports non-blocking sockets now. Many other fixes in ↵dom962011-04-306-38/+223
| | | | | | | | sockets. Timeout support in scgi.
* | cleaned up the tests; fixes #30; fixes #26Araq2011-05-0152-319/+459
|/
* Merge branch 'master' of github.com:Araq/NimrodAraq2011-04-301-40/+62
|\
| * Some minor fixes and additions to the graphics module.dom962011-04-261-40/+62
| |
* | c sources regenerated to get rid of execinfo.h dependencyAraq2011-04-291-6/+6
| |